For … Webthen the R 2 can be negative. This is because, without the benefit of an intercept, the regression could do worse than the sample mean in terms of tracking the dependent variable (i.e., the numerator could be greater than the denominator). What is a good MSE value? (simply explained) - Stephen Allwright

There is no MSE value which is considered ‘normal’ as it’s an absolute error score which is unique to that model and dataset. For example, a house price prediction model will have much larger MSE values than a model which predicts height, as they are predicting for very different scales. WebJan 28, 2024 · Well, if you get NaN values in your cost function, it means that the input is outside of the function domain. E.g. the logarithm of 0. Or it could be in the domain analytically, but due to numerical errors we get the same problem (e.g. a small value gets rounded to 0). It has nothing to do with an inability to "settle".
